When is the best time to visit Kelowna?
| Month |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| June | July | Aug | Sept | Oct | Nov | Dec |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g. price | $160 AUD | $166 AUD | $173 AUD | $184 AUD | $215 AUD | $239 AUD | $245 AUD | $241 AUD | $195 AUD | $171 AUD | $160 AUD | $167 AUD |
| Avg. temp | -3°C | 0°C | 5°C | 10°C | 15°C | 18°C | 22°C | 21°C | 16°C | 9°C | 2°C | -2°C |

How is the weather in Kelowna?
Kelowna has cold winters around 22–39°F (-6–4°C) and warm, dry summers near 77–85°F (25–29°C). Spring and fall see milder temperatures with occasional rain, so layered clothing is useful year-round.

What are some hiking trails in Kelowna?
Kelowna has hiking options like Knox Mountain Park trails, Myra Canyon’s trestle bridges, and the Bear Creek area near the city. Trails range from easy lakeside walks to more strenuous viewpoints.
